Federer wins after Simon suffers injury
Roger Federer advanced to the semi-finals of the Sony Ericsson Open when his quarter-final opponent Gilles Simon retired from their match due to injury.
Frenchman Simon had won two of his previous three matches against Federer but was trailing 3-0 in the first set of their Miami clash when he pulled out, citing a neck problem.
